Good job finishing your first jam game. I liked the concept of having a sequence of unique door lock puzzles for the player to solve. The key dropped in the grate was a fun one, though it took me a bit to figure out what the screwdriver was supposed to be while looking at it, and I still don't know what the loopy thing was. The collision for the platforming part of the game was very janky and I think it detracted from the experience - perhaps you would have been better off discarding that part entirely and focusing more on your core mechanic, the door puzzles.
